The Mark Levinson No. 5105 turntable is a high-performance, precision-engineered analog turntable designed for audiophiles.
Design and Build
Front Panel and Display: Features a 1-inch thick, bead-blasted, black-anodized solid aluminum front panel that seamlessly integrates with a recessed tinted glass display framed by a clear-anodized aluminum bezel.
Plinth: Nearly 2-inch thick solid aluminum plinth machined from a single billet, suspended on three adjustable aluminum feet with internal suspension for vibration isolation.
Weight: Weighs approximately 69 to 75 lbs, depending on the configuration.
Tonearm and Cartridge
Tonearm: Custom 10-inch high-gloss black carbon fiber tonearm with a solid aluminum headshell and integrated finger lift. The tonearm is height adjustable and has an effective length of 254 mm (10 inches).
Cartridge: Pre-mounted Ortofon Quintet Black S moving coil cartridge with a Shibata nude diamond stylus (optional in some configurations).
Cartridge Type: Moving Coil (MC).
Platter and Bearing
Platter: A 14 lb solid aluminum platter with ultra-precise bearings, supported by a ground-hardened steel axle. It features an oil-free composite bearing bottom with integrated lubrication and maintenance-free sintered brass bushing.
Platter Mat: Comes with a signature platter mat.
Motor and Drive System
Motor Type: Isolated 12V synchronous motor with digitally generated control signals for speed stability and ultra-low wow/flutter. The motor is temperature drift-free.
Drive Type: Belt drive supporting playback speeds of 33 1/3 RPM and 45 RPM.
Power Supply
Integrated wide-range power supply compatible with global voltage (90–260 VAC). Includes four regional AC cables (US, EU, UK, JP).
Outputs
Single phono audio output via RCA connectors

Dimensions
Height: 6.1 inches
Width: 17.2 inches
Depth: 15.6 inches.
Additional Features
Integrated bubble level for precise leveling.
Delivered in a luxurious packaging styled as a double LP gatefold jacket.
Designed and engineered in the USA.
This turntable combines robust materials, meticulous engineering, and elegant aesthetics to deliver exceptional analog sound quality
